WebWhat is tepid sponge bath used for? Tepid sponging is the application of water to the patient's skin surface to promote dispersal of body heat when the body temperature is 39.5°C and over. The procedure is based on the principles of evaporation and conduction. What's a tepid bath? 1 : moderately warm: lukewarm a tepid bath. May 23, 2012 #1 Vicki78 Member. 5 Year … Websitz bath immersion of only the hips and buttocks, done to relieve pain and discomfort following rectal surgery, cystoscopy, or vaginal surgery; sitz baths also may be ordered for patients with cystitis or infections in the pelvic cavity. Temperature for a hot sitz bath is started at 35°C (95°F) and gradually increased to 40 to 43°C (104° to 110°F).

WebOct 25, 2024 · What is tepid bath water? tepid bath one in water 24° to 33°C (75° to 92°F). warm bath one in water just under body temperature, 33° to 37°C (92° to 98°F). Is a hot bath good for a fever? Many people find that taking a lukewarm [80°F (27°C) to 90°F (32°C)] shower or bath makes them feel better when they have a fever.
